Transaction 346cf71183f53b6808a9bde8d5038c857e31273cf419cda2979efcc9cdf9c013

1 Input
1 Outputs
  • 346cf71183f53b6808a9bde8d5038c857e31273cf419cda2979efcc9cdf9c013:0
  • value  509138
    address  3FZ8DfNjdzxwppCf3XKFjvPEjnfn9vkx5c